- Hold an current early childhood professional credential level II or higher in version 3.0, as determined by the Colorado Department of Early Childhood, have a minimum of nine (9) months (1,365 hours) of verifiable experience in the care and supervision of infants and/or toddlers, and:
- (a) Has completed one (1) three (3) semester credit hour course in infant/toddler development; or
- (b) Has completed the Department-approved expanding quality in infant and toddler care training course.

✓All employees in Colorado are eligible for paid sick leave, as required by the Healthy Families Work Act. Full-time employees are provided with 48 hours upon hire and annually each fiscal year thereafter. Part-time and temporary employees earn paid sick leave based upon hours worked.
